Output f3ca3a6455a1574f3bc9061344bc16d6af13742fee1e5736471e4865935b39f1:1

value
503423
script pubkey
OP_0 OP_PUSHBYTES_20 d8c723605786c0bbd467528cac0f231b36b19fef
address
bc1qmrrjxczhsmqth4r822x2crerrvmtr8l0vh4w40
transaction
f3ca3a6455a1574f3bc9061344bc16d6af13742fee1e5736471e4865935b39f1
confirmations
181574
spent
true